Division 6 Football League
Ballycomoyle 3-17 Delvin 3-03
Delvin took to the field in their opening Division 6 League fixture on Easter Monday against Ballycomoyle. It will be a game Delvin’s footballers will want to forget as they were comprehensively beaten in a one sided affair.
Ballycomoyle started strongly and kicked some nice frees to push them clear of Delvin. A well taken goal midday through the half had Ballycomyle in a strong position by half time.
Ballycomoyle kicked on in the second half and a further two goals as well as some nicely taken points seen them run out easy winners. A hat trick of goals from wing half forward Jamie Walsh in the second half was one of the only positives Delvin can take from a poor display.
Team and scorers: S.Reilly, S. Carroll, C. Ward, E.O’Neill, B. O’Brien, P. Clune, A. McCormack, P. Kelly, K.Murphy (0-03), J. Cogan, A. Clune, J. Walsh (3-00), D. Poynton, F. Cox and J. Vaughan. Subs Used: S. Gaffney, J.Murphy and E. Halpin
Leinster League Division 3 Semi- Final
Our hurlers are scheduled to meet Naas from Kildare in the semi-final of the Leinster League next Saturday April 9th. It is great to get these competitive games as Westmeath reaching the relegation/promotion play-off v Laois has pushed back the hurling championship start by a few weeks.
